About Finedon
Finedon is a village located in Northamptonshire, England, within the NN9 postcode area. It is situated approximately four miles east of Wellingborough and offers a mix of residential and rural settings. The village features a range of local amenities, including shops and a primary school, catering to the needs of its residents.
The area is also known for its historical significance, with several notable buildings, such as St. Mary's Church, which dates back to the 13th century. Finedon is surrounded by picturesque countryside, making it a pleasant spot for outdoor activities and walks. The village has a strong sense of community, with various local events and gatherings throughout the year.

Household Income in Finedon ONS 2023
The average total household income in Finedon is approximately £50,528 a year before tax, 9%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£35,917.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Finedon ONS 2025
There are approximately 1,093 active businesses based in Finedon, around 39 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 93%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 6 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Finedon
Of the 12,138 households in and around Finedon, 71% are owned, 15% are socially rented and 14%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Finedon.
